踏入C语言的世界,让我们从基础语句和代码实践开始。重要的是多看、多写,以下是C语言编程路上的100个必备代码片段,涵盖了各种实用技巧和解决方案:
优雅的9x9乘法表: 让数字的魅力在屏幕上呈现。
旋转4x4数组的艺术: 理解数据结构的灵活性。
斐波那契兔子的智慧: 学习递归算法,探索自然的规律。
素数探索者: 101-200之间的秘密,检验数列的神秘力量。
寻找完美之数: 在1000以内寻找那些神秘的完数。
直角三角的几何之美: 理解杨辉三角在编程中的应用。
公平的分配法则: 计算平均数,解决分配问题。
字符世界的逆转: 反转字符串,文字游戏的新挑战。
字符数组的瘦身术: 学习如何精简和操作字符序列。
从乱序到有序: 探索sort函数的力量,实现大到小的排序。
插入排序的艺术: 保持有序的秘密,一步步提升编程技艺。
文字游戏:替换输出: 深入理解字符串操作,实现字符替换。
每一个代码片段都是你掌握C语言能力的基石,通过实例和实践,你将逐步掌握基础语法和常用算法。让我们一起通过这些代码片段,探索C语言的无限可能。
深入学习与实践
字符串替换的艺术: replace.c, 实现c1替换为c2,见证代码的魔力。
子串搜索者: 查找.c, 学会查找s2在s1中的位置,提高文本处理能力。
指针与结构体的亲密接触: 输出结构体数组.c, 用指针和数组下标解锁结构体的奥秘。
链表初探: 建立简单链表.c, 学习链表的基本构建。
冒泡排序的魔力: 冒泡排序.c, 见证算法如何改变数据的顺序。
回文的辨识: 回文判断.c, 探索字符串对称的奇妙世界。
计算π的精确: 编写π函数.c, 让数学与编程相遇。
想要了解更多实战代码,加入我们的【C语言/C++互助学习群】,一起探索编程的无限乐趣。